Since the dawn of humanity, a privileged few have lived in stark contrast to the hardscrabble majority. Conventional wisdom says this gap cannot be closed. But it is closing - fast. The authors document how four forces are conspiring to solve our biggest problems. Examining human need by category - water, food, energy, healthcare, education, freedom - Diamandis and Kotler introduce dozens of innovators making the great strides in each area: Larry Page, Stephen Hawking, Dean Kamen, Daniel Kahneman, among many others.
